Product Overview

Category: Power MOSFET
Use: Switching applications in power supplies and motor control
Characteristics: High voltage, high speed switching, low on-resistance
Package: TO-220AB
Essence: Power MOSFET for efficient switching
Packaging/Quantity: Tube/50 units

Specifications

  • Voltage Rating: 100V
  • Continuous Drain Current: 97A
  • RDS(ON): 4.5mΩ
  • Gate-Source Voltage (Max): ±20V
  • Power Dissipation: 200W

Working Principles

The IRFS4410ZPBF operates based on the principles of field-effect transistors, utilizing the voltage applied to the gate to control the flow of current between the drain and source terminals.
